Video Journalist, Weekend News

The New York Times is looking for a video journalist to join their expanding video team in a role focused on breaking news and live journalism, emphasizing independent reporting and storytelling through video.

Skills

  • Proficient in Adobe Premiere Pro
  • Strong editorial and writing skills
  • Experience in digital video journalism
  • Ability to work under tight deadlines

Responsibilities

  • Source, script and edit live, breaking news video packages for the site and off-platform
  • Set up and monitor live feeds, adding text and graphics as needed
  • Find, verify and acquire user-generated content
  • Write succinct and effective copy for video assets
  • Coordinate with social team on the creation of news clips for social media
  • Collaborate with visual editors on social formats

Education

  • Bachelor's degree in Journalism, Media, or related field

Benefits

  • Health, dental, and vision insurance
  • 401(k) plan with company match
  • Generous paid time off policy
  • Professional development opportunities
